EX

Financial Aid Counselor

Excelsior
Posted 1 hour ago
🇺🇸United States🏢Hybrid💰$40.9K–$42K📁Finance
Is this job info correct?

As a financial aid counselor, you will play a crucial role in assisting students in navigating the financial aid process, ensuring access to education through effective financial planning. Your responsibilities will include evaluating financial aid applications, counseling students on available aid programs, and providing information about funding options. This position requires a keen understanding of financial aid regulations, excellent communication skills, and a commitment to promoting accessibility to education. We believe work should fit your life, not the other way around. Our hybrid schedule includes two days on site in our Albany office, with the flexibility to work remotely the remaining days. Spend less time commuting and more time focusing on meaningful work or personal priorities. Core hours are 8:30 AM–5:00 PM, including a 1-hour lunch, for a 37.5-hour week Duties and Responsibilities: Financial Aid Advising: - Provide individualized counseling to students regarding financial aid options, eligibility criteria, and application procedures over the phone, email, text, and in virtual meetings. - Assist students in understanding different types of financial aid programs and amounts of funding available, including grants, scholarships, loans, etc. Application Processing: - Evaluate financial aid applications, ensuring accuracy and compliance with federal, state, and institutional guidelines - Collaborate with other depts to obtain necessary documentation and information for financial aid assessments. - Review financial aid packages based on students eligibility and financial need - Communicate award information clearly to students, addressing any inquiries and providing additional guidance as needed - Conduct workshops and informational sessions to educate students a parents about the financial aid process, application deadlines, and available resources - Stay current on federal and state financial aid regulations, ensuring adherence to compliance requirements in all aspects of financial aid administration - Attend trainings and conferences to enhance professional development Maintain accurate and confidential student records related to financial aid applications, awards, and communications - Provide excellent student service by promptly responding to inquiries, resolving issues, and guiding students through the financial aid process - Collaborate with other departments, such as admissions and academic advising, to ensure a coordinated approach in supporting students financial needs - Other duties as assigned to support the unit or institution Qualifications: To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. - Associate degree in a relevant field (e.g., finance, business, education). - Previous experience in financial aid administration or related field preferred. - Knowledge of federal and state financial aid regulations. - Strong interpersonal and communication skills. - Ability to interpret and explain complex financial information to diverse audiences. - Detail-oriented with excellent organizational and time management skills - Experience in PowerFAIDS preferred The hiring salary range for this position is $40,875- 42,000.00. The hiring salary range above represents the University's good faith estimate at the time of posting.
